What a personal loan costs in Van Horne

Personal loans are installment credit — one lump sum, repaid in equal monthly installments across a fixed term you agree to up front.

The APR is the comparable price of a loan since it folds in fees; model any offer with the personal loan calculator first.

A longer term reduces what you owe each month and increases the total interest, which is the trade-off to weigh before choosing one.

Work out the payment you can comfortably carry each month first, then borrow no more than that figure supports.

Iowa lending rules that apply in Van Horne

The sourced rows below are the rules a licensed lender must follow when lending in Iowa, and therefore in Van Horne.

How to compare offers in Van Horne

A few practical steps will make the process in Van Horne less costly:

  1. Pull your free credit reports and dispute any error — it is the cheapest way to improve the rate you are offered.
  2. Run your figures through the personal loan calculator on this site so you know the payment before a lender quotes one.
  3. Pre-qualify with at least three lenders and compare the APR, not the interest rate.
  4. Check that the lender is licensed in Iowa using the regulator named above.
  5. Read the disclosure for origination fees and any prepayment penalty before you sign.

Does a personal loan in Van Horne require collateral?
Unsecured personal loans do not require collateral. A secured loan, such as a home-equity or auto-secured loan, does — and it puts the pledged asset at risk if you default.
Will shopping for a loan in Van Horne hurt my credit?
Pre-qualification usually uses a soft credit pull that does not affect your score. A full application triggers a hard inquiry, which may lower your score by a few points temporarily.
